Top Career Options After BSc CSIT You Should Know

examsanjal

1. Software Developer & Software Engineer

One of the most sought-after career paths for BSc CSIT graduates is that of a software developer. In this role, professionals design, develop and maintain software applications for various platforms, including desktop, mobile, and web. Software developers are the architects behind the digital tools we use daily, from productivity apps to complex enterprise systems.

  1. Analyzing user requirements
  2. Designing software solutions
  3. Writing clean, efficient code
  4. Testing and debugging applications
  5. Collaborating with cross-functional teams
  1. Lok Sewa Aayog PSC vacancy for various ministry & district-level offices
  2. Nepal Rastra Bank NRB
  3. Rastriya Banijya Bank RBB
  4. Nepal Bank Limited NBL
  5. Agriculture Development Bank ADBL
  6. Nepal Oil Corporation
  7. Employment Provident Fund Office EPF
  8. Citizens Investment Trust CIT
  9. Social Security Fund SSF Office
  10. Nepal Telecom
  11. Radio Nepal/ NTV
  12. Nepal Police Service
  13. Nepal Army Service
  14. Nepal Armed Police Force Service

2. Data Scientist

In the age of big data, data scientists have become indispensable across industries. BSc CSIT graduates with a strong foundation in statistics and machine learning can excel in this role, which involves extracting meaningful insights from vast amounts of data to drive business decisions.

Data scientists typically engage in:

  1. Collecting and cleaning large datasets
  2. Developing predictive models
  3. Applying advanced analytics techniques
  4. Visualizing data to communicate findings
  5. Implementing machine learning algorithms

As organizations increasingly rely on data-driven decision-making, the demand for skilled data scientists continues to grow exponentially.

3. Cybersecurity Specialist

With the rising frequency and sophistication of cyber threats, the role of a cybersecurity specialist has become critical in safeguarding digital assets. BSc CSIT graduates can leverage their knowledge of network security and cryptography to build robust defense systems against potential attacks.

Cybersecurity specialists are responsible for:

  1. Implementing security protocols
  2. Conducting vulnerability assessments
  3. Developing incident response plans
  4. Educating employees on best security practices
  5. Staying updated on emerging threats and countermeasures

As cyber threats evolve, so does the need for skilled professionals to protect sensitive information and maintain the integrity of digital infrastructure.

4. Cloud Computing Engineer

The shift towards cloud-based solutions has created a high demand for cloud computing engineers. These professionals design, implement, and manage cloud infrastructure, ensuring scalability, security, and efficiency for organizations of all sizes.

Cloud computing engineers focus on:

  1. Architecting cloud-based solutions
  2. Migrating existing systems to the cloud
  3. Optimizing cloud performance and costs
  4. Implementing cloud security measures
  5. Troubleshooting cloud-related issues

As more businesses adopt cloud technologies, the opportunities for cloud computing engineers continue to expand across various industries.

5. Artificial Intelligence (AI) Engineer

The field of artificial intelligence is at the forefront of technological innovation, and BSc CSIT graduates with a passion for AI can pursue exciting careers as AI engineers. These professionals develop intelligent systems that can learn, adapt, and make decisions with minimal human intervention.

AI engineers are involved in:

  1. Developing machine learning models
  2. Implementing natural language processing systems
  3. Creating computer vision applications
  4. Designing and training neural networks
  5. Integrating AI solutions into existing infrastructure

As AI technologies continue to advance, the demand for skilled AI engineers is expected to soar across industries, from healthcare to finance and beyond.

6. DevOps Engineer

DevOps engineers bridge the gap between software development and IT operations, streamlining the software delivery process and improving collaboration between teams. BSc CSIT graduates with a holistic understanding of both development and operations can thrive in this role.

Key responsibilities of DevOps engineers include:

  1. Implementing continuous integration and delivery (CI/CD) pipelines
  2. Automating deployment processes
  3. Managing infrastructure as code
  4. Monitoring system performance and reliability
  5. Collaborating with development and operations teams

As organizations strive for faster and more efficient software delivery, the role of DevOps engineers has become increasingly crucial in modern IT environments.

7. UI/UX Designer

For BSc CSIT graduates with a creative flair, a career as a UI/UX designer offers the perfect blend of technical knowledge and artistic expression. These professionals focus on creating intuitive, visually appealing interfaces that enhance user experience across digital platforms.

UI/UX designers are responsible for:

  1. Conducting user research and analysis
  2. Creating wireframes and prototypes
  3. Designing user-friendly interfaces
  4. Collaborating with developers to implement designs
  5. Conducting usability testing and gathering feedback

As the importance of user experience in digital products continues to grow, skilled UI/UX designers are in high demand across various industries.

8. Database Administrator

Database administrators (DBAs) play a crucial role in managing and optimizing an organization’s data storage and retrieval systems. BSc CSIT graduates with strong database management skills can excel in this role, ensuring data integrity, security, and accessibility.

DBAs are typically involved in:

  1. Designing and implementing database structures
  2. Monitoring database performance and troubleshooting issues
  3. Implementing backup and recovery strategies
  4. Managing user access and security
  5. Optimizing database queries and performance

As data continues to be a valuable asset for organizations, the role of database administrators remains essential in maintaining efficient and secure data management systems.

9. IT Consultant

For BSc CSIT graduates who enjoy problem-solving and working with diverse clients, a career as an IT consultant can be both challenging and rewarding. IT consultants provide expert advice on technology-related issues and help organizations optimize their IT infrastructure and processes.

Key responsibilities include:

  1. Analyzing clients’ IT needs and challenges
  2. Recommending appropriate technology solutions
  3. Developing IT strategies and implementation plans
  4. Managing IT projects and overseeing their execution
  5. Providing training and support to clients

IT consultants have the opportunity to work across various industries, gaining diverse experience and continuously expanding their knowledge base.

10. Technical Writer

For BSc CSIT graduates with strong communication skills, a career as a technical writer offers the opportunity to bridge the gap between complex technical concepts and end-users. Technical writers create clear, concise documentation for software, hardware, and other technical products.

Technical writers are responsible for:

  1. Researching and understanding complex technical information
  2. Writing user manuals, guides, and online help documentation
  3. Creating tutorials and instructional videos
  4. Collaborating with subject matter experts and developers
  5. Ensuring documentation adheres to industry standards and best practices

11. Machine Learning Engineer

As a subset of AI, machine learning has gained significant traction in recent years. Machine learning engineers specialize in developing systems that can learn and improve from experience without being explicitly programmed. BSc CSIT graduates with a strong foundation in algorithms and statistical modeling can excel in this field.

Machine learning engineers typically:

  1. Design and implement machine learning algorithms
  2. Develop predictive models and recommendation systems
  3. Optimize machine learning systems for scalability
  4. Collaborate with data scientists and software engineers
  5. Stay updated on the latest advancements in machine-learning techniques

The applications of machine learning are vast, ranging from autonomous vehicles to personalized marketing, making it an exciting and rapidly growing field for BSc CSIT graduates.

12. Blockchain Developer

With the rise of cryptocurrencies and decentralized applications, blockchain technology has emerged as a disruptive force across industries. Blockchain developers create and implement decentralized applications (DApps) and smart contracts using blockchain platforms like Ethereum or Hyperledger.

Key responsibilities include:

  1. Developing and deploying smart contracts
  2. Creating decentralized applications (DApps)
  3. Implementing consensus mechanisms
  4. Ensuring the security and efficiency of blockchain networks
  5. Collaborating with cross-functional teams to integrate blockchain solutions

As blockchain technology continues to mature and find applications beyond cryptocurrencies, the demand for skilled blockchain developers is expected to grow significantly.

13. IoT (Internet of Things) Specialist

The Internet of Things (IoT) has revolutionized how we interact with everyday objects, creating a network of interconnected devices. IoT specialists design, develop, and maintain systems that enable seamless communication between various smart devices.

IoT specialists focus on:

  1. Developing IoT hardware and software solutions
  2. Implementing secure communication protocols
  3. Managing and analyzing data from IoT devices
  4. Integrating IoT systems with existing infrastructure
  5. Addressing privacy and security concerns in IoT networks

As the number of connected devices continues to grow exponentially, IoT specialists play a crucial role in shaping the future of smart homes, cities, and industries.

14. Game Developer

For BSc CSIT graduates with a passion for gaming and creativity, a career as a game developer offers an exciting opportunity to blend technical skills with artistic expression. Game developers create interactive experiences for various platforms, including consoles, PCs, and mobile devices.

Game developers are involved in:

  1. Designing game mechanics and storylines
  2. Implementing game logic and physics
  3. Creating 3D models and animations
  4. Optimizing game performance across different platforms
  5. Collaborating with artists, designers, and sound engineers

With the global gaming industry continuing to grow, skilled game developers are in high demand, especially those with expertise in emerging technologies like virtual and augmented reality.

15. Robotics Engineer

As automation becomes increasingly prevalent across industries, robotics engineers play a vital role in designing, building, and maintaining robotic systems. BSc CSIT graduates with a strong background in programming and control systems can thrive in this field.

Robotics engineers typically:

  1. Design and prototype robotic systems
  2. Develop control algorithms for autonomous robots
  3. Implement computer vision and sensor integration
  4. Collaborate with mechanical and electrical engineers
  5. Test and refine robotic systems for various applications

From manufacturing to healthcare and space exploration, robotics engineers are at the forefront of technological innovation, creating machines that can perform complex tasks with precision and efficiency.

As the technology landscape continues to evolve, BSc CSIT graduates must stay abreast of emerging trends and continuously update their skills to remain competitive in the job market. Some key areas to focus on include:

  1. Quantum Computing: As quantum computers become more accessible, understanding quantum algorithms and their applications will be a valuable skill.
  2. Edge Computing: With the need for real-time processing in IoT and mobile devices, expertise in edge computing architectures is becoming increasingly important.
  3. 5G and Beyond: As 5G networks roll out globally, understanding the implications and applications of high-speed, low-latency communications will be crucial.
  4. Ethical AI: As AI systems become more prevalent, there’s a growing need for professionals who can address ethical concerns and ensure responsible AI development.
  5. Green IT: With increasing focus on sustainability, knowledge of energy-efficient computing and green technology solutions is becoming more valuable.

As technology continues to evolve, the demand for skilled technical writers who can effectively communicate complex information remains strong.

In conclusion, a BSc CSIT degree opens doors to a wide array of exciting and rewarding career paths in the ever-expanding field of technology. Whether you’re passionate about coding, data analysis, cybersecurity, or user experience, there’s a career option that aligns with your interests and skills. By staying current with industry trends and continuously upgrading your skills, you can build a successful and fulfilling career in the dynamic world of IT.

Share This Article

Copyright © 2026 Exam Sanjal. All Rights Reserved